Oven Bad Smell: Identify Gas, Electrical, Food, and New-Oven Odors
Do not treat every oven smell as the same problem. First identify whether the oven is gas, electric, dual-fuel, or unknown, and whether the smell is gas-like, electrical or burnt plastic, food or grease, cleaning chemical, or a mild new-appliance odor.

Oven bake element heats unevenly: What to Check and What to Do Next
An oven bake element that heats unevenly may have a visible element defect, a power or control problem, a temperature-sensor or calibration issue, a door-seal or airflow problem, or a cooking setup that makes heat look uneven. After the oven is fully cool, use only ordinary user access to check the selected bake mode, rack and pan placement, door closure, and any visible break, blister, or area of an exposed electric element that never glows during a normal preheat.

Oven Leaking: Tell Condensation, Spills, and Gas Odor Apart
An oven that appears to be leaking may be releasing food liquid, steam condensation, water from a model-specific steam or cleaning function, or a true leak from a door, reservoir, or internal component. Let the oven cool, identify the first wet point, and check whether the moisture appeared after high-moisture food, steam use, or cleaning.

Oven Making Noise: Normal Fans, Clicks, Popping, and Warning Sounds
Some oven noise is designed operation: a cooling or convection fan can hum and continue after a cycle, relays can click as heating is controlled, and metal can crack or pop as it heats and cools. The useful first distinction is gas versus electric, then the sound's timing, location, and effect on cooking.

Oven overheating: separate normal cycling from a fault
First distinguish normal heat from uncontrolled overheating. Warm glass, an operating cooling fan, and elements cycling on and off can be normal for some models, while food burning at a normal setting, a temperature that keeps rising, an oven that continues heating after shutoff, smoke, an abnormal flame, gas odor, arcing, or a breaker trip is not.

Oven Sparking: Separate Normal Gas Ignition From Dangerous Arcing
An oven spark can be normal only in a model-documented gas ignition sequence and only when it is brief, localized, and followed by stable combustion. A spark, flash, crackle, or arc from the cavity, control area, cord, outlet, element, or wiring is not a normal test result.
